Well, it remains to be seen if they fix the truck or not.  Talked to the "claims counselor" and he said a truck that old may be deemed a total loss.  Cost of repair vs. wholesale value.  I told him if they total it, they will be paying for the damage AND I will be keeping the truck... no negotiation on that.  I looked up the parts that it will take to put it back to what it was.  That comes to right at $2000.00.  Add the labor to replace the parts along with the labor, paint and materials for the lower R.H. bed corner and that will push it past wholesale value, which KBB states is $2619.00.  My thoughts are: I had a nice truck that I was happy driving.  Their driver took that away.  If I have to replace that truck with a comparable vehicle, it will cost $9000 or more... IF I can find one.
